By: Priya Chowdhary Nuthalapti | 22 Oct 2025 2:48 PM ISTActress Sapthami Gowda known for her powerful performance as Leela in Kantara, recently shared a photo on Instagram to wish everyone a Happy Deepavali. The actress looked graceful in a traditional silk saree perfectly capturing the festive spirit of the season.
In her caption, Sapthami wrote a heartfelt message in Kannada, wishing everyone “Belakina Habba Deepavaliya Haadika Shubhashayagalu,” which means “Best wishes for the festival of lights.” She also added a simple English line, “Happy Deepawali to all,” along with diya and sparkle emojis, spreading love and positivity among her followers.
In the photo, Sapthami wore a green silk saree with an elegant peach border, creating a perfect combination of tradition and charm. Her smile and natural confidence made the picture glow with festive warmth. The actress completed her traditional look with classic gold jewellery from Gajraj Jewellers, including bangles, earrings, and a long necklace that matched beautifully with her outfit.
Her blouse was designed by Abhivyakti Keegadi Designs, which added a touch of sophistication to her entire look. The styling was done by Rachna Satish, who kept it simple yet rich in traditional elegance. The actress’s hair and makeup were handled by Romithokchom, who gave her a natural glow, enhancing her features without overpowering her traditional attire.

Sapthami Gowda, who started her career with Popcorn Monkey Tiger in 2020, rose to fame with Kantara in 2022, directed by Rishab Shetty. She has also appeared in The Vaccine War, directed by Vivek Agnihotri, marking her Bollywood debut. The actress was last seen in her first Telugu film Thamuudu opposite Nithin directed by Venu Sriram.
